SPPD investigating shots fired at Brookside Park Apartments

Published on

A juvenile was shot in Southern Pines on Sunday afternoon, according to the Southern Pines Police Department. The shooting took place in Brookside Park Apartment complex near Morganton Road Sports Complex.

Moore County EMS responded to the scene, but was cancelled after the victim reportedly was arrived at the emergency room in a private vehicle.

SPPD Deputy Chief Charles Campbell confirmed to Moore County News the victim sustained non-life-threatening injuries.

“This was not a random act of violence and is still an active investigation,” Campbell said.
